Basic facts about this digital color

The digital color #FB1CE9 is classified in the Register under the Magenta Color Family, with Full Saturation and Light brightness. In numbers: rgb(251, 28, 233) (98.4% red, 11% green, 91.4% blue), or CMYK 0 / 87 / 7 / 2 for print. New to color codes? See our guide to RGB color codes.

The color #FB1CE9 reads as a intensely saturated purple-pink magenta and carries an easy, daylight feel. Designers typically reach for tones like this for logos, highlights and anything that needs to be noticed first. In The Official Register of Color Names it is very close to Bright Magenta (#FF08E8). Slightly further away sit Hot Magenta (#FF1DCE) and Solar Power Pink (#FC05F9).

The recipe behind #FB1CE9 is rgb(251, 28, 233), with red as the dominant ingredient. On this background, black text reaches a 6.4:1 contrast ratio (passing WCAG AA); white stays at 3.3:1. #FB1CE9 has no official name yet. If this shade means something to you, you can be the one to name it.

#FB1CE9 color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Complementary color schemes

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Split complementary color scheme

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Analogous color scheme

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Triadic color scheme

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Tetradic color scheme

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
